Fonctions First, FirstN, Last et LastN dans PowerAppsFirst, FirstN, Last, and LastN functions in PowerApps

Permet de renvoyer le premier ou le dernier jeu d’enregistrements d’une table.Returns a table's first or last set of records.

DescriptionDescription

La fonction First renvoie le premier enregistrement d’une table.The First function returns the first record of a table.

La fonction FirstN renvoie le premier jeu d’enregistrements d’une table ; le deuxième argument spécifie le nombre d’enregistrements à renvoyer.The FirstN function returns the first set of records of a table; the second argument specifies the number of records to return.

La fonction Last renvoie le dernier enregistrement d’une table.The Last function returns the last record of a table.

La fonction LastN renvoie le dernier jeu d’enregistrements d’une table ; le deuxième argument spécifie le nombre d’enregistrements à renvoyer.The LastN function returns the last set of records of a table; the second argument specifies the number of records to return.

First et Last renvoient un enregistrement unique.First and Last return a single record. FirstN et LastN renvoient une table, même si vous spécifiez un enregistrement seul.FirstN and LastN return a table, even if you specify only a single record.

Lorsqu’elles sont utilisées avec une source de données, ces fonctions ne peuvent pas être déléguées.When used with a data source, these functions can't be delegated. Seule la première partie de la source de données est récupérée, puis la fonction est appliquée.Only the first portion of the data source will be retrieved and then the function applied. Le résultat peut donc être incomplet.The result may not represent the complete story. Un point bleu apparaît au moment de l’autorisation pour vous rappeler cette limitation et vous suggérer d’utiliser des fonctions équivalentes pouvant être déléguées lorsque vous le pouvez.A blue dot will appear at authoring time to remind you of this limitation and to suggest switching to delegable alternatives where possible. Pour plus d’informations, consultez la vue d’ensemble des délégations.For more information, see the delegation overview.

SyntaxeSyntax

First( Table )First( Table )
Last( Table )Last( Table )

  • Table : requis.Table - Rquired. Table à utiliser.Table to operate on.

FirstN( Table [, NumberOfRecords ] )FirstN( Table [, NumberOfRecords ] )
LastN( Table [, NumberOfRecords ] )LastN( Table [, NumberOfRecords ] )

  • Table - Requis.Table - Required. Table à utiliser.Table to operate on.
  • NumberOfRecords : facultatif.NumberOfRecords - Optional. Nombre d’enregistrements à renvoyer.Number of records to return. Si vous ne spécifiez pas cet argument, la fonction renvoie un enregistrement.If you don't specify this argument, the function returns one record.

ExemplesExamples

Cette formule renvoie le premier enregistrement d’une table appelée Employees :This formula returns the first record from a table named Employees:
First(Employees)First(Employees)

Cette formule renvoie les 15 derniers enregistrements d’une table appelée Employees :This formula returns the last 15 records from a table named Employees:
LastN(Employees, 15)LastN(Employees, 15)